None - Community
Doriti să reactionati la acest mesaj? Creati un cont în câteva clickuri sau conectati-vă pentru a continua.

[TUTORIAL]Instalare Server Counter-Strike 1.6 (NON-STEAM)

2 participan?i

In jos

[TUTORIAL]Instalare Server Counter-Strike 1.6 (NON-STEAM) Empty [TUTORIAL]Instalare Server Counter-Strike 1.6 (NON-STEAM)

Mesaj  knoxville Vin Mai 09, 2008 12:34 pm

Te-ai saturat de codati sau de primit ban degeaba si te-ai hotarat sa iti faci propriul server de Counter-Strike dar nu stii de unde sa incepi . Cauti pe Internet Tutoriale , gasesti , iar dupa ce citesti 10 randuri te pierzi cu totul...solutia ta este aici ! Acesta este un tutorial facut de catre mine , nu este copiat iar aici va voi invata sa va faceti un server de Counter-Strike 1.6 . Cea mai simpla metoda de creeare a serverului este de a descarca Counter-Strike 1.6 Server Creator Beta 1.0 de aici . Cu ajutorul acestui lui , programul va va downloada resursele necesare pentru un server de Counter-Strike 1.6 + modul AdminMod(bineinteles mod-ul il puteti modifica) . Cand intrati in program , va aparea urmatoarea imagine :
[TUTORIAL]Instalare Server Counter-Strike 1.6 (NON-STEAM) 55947207vk5

Bun , el va incepe acum sa downloadeze fisierele pentru server . Asteptati pana dispare aceasta fereastra .

Ok , aceasta a fost cel mai simpla modalitate de a creea servere de Counter-Strike . Acum vine partea mai grea , parte pentru cei care vor sa invete sa devina maestrii in servere de Counter-Strike . In primul rand aveti nevoie de un calculator BUN pe care puteti tine serverul . Cerintele MINIME pentru a creea un server sunt :
• Windows XP , cel PUTIN un procesor de 1GHZ si memorie de 256MB RAM .
• O conexiune la Internet (viteza cel putin 100kB/s local si extern) prin FIBRA OPTICA . Abonamentele de gen RDS CableLink sau Astral NU sunt recomandate din mai multe motive , cum ar fi ca in primul rand Ping-ul pe server va sari de la 10 la 100 si mai mult de 5-10 jucatori nu veti putea tine pe server .
• De preferat , IP Stabil (daca aveti IP Dinamic , gasiti tutorial aici)
• Cel putin 1GB spatiu pe Hard-Disk-ul pe care doriti sa instalati serverul .

Acum avem nevoie de niste fisiere :

• Half-Life Dedicated Server Update Tool . Descarcare de aici
• Non-Steam Patch (patch pentru a accepta clienti NON-STEAM pe server) . Descarcare de aici
• AdminMod + Metamod . Descarcare de aici
• StatsMe 2.8.3 . Descarcare de aici

Acum sa incepem sa instalam serverul . Dam dublu-click pe Start si click pe butonul My Computer . Intram in Hard-Disk-ul C si creem un folder numit HLDS . Urmatorul pas este sa deschidem hldsupdatetool dam click pe Next -> I Agree -> la Destination Folder alegem Hard-Disk-ul C si folder-ul care l-am creeat noi mai sus , adica HLDS . Ne spune ca folder-ul dat exista deja apasam Yes , apoi Next pana la sfarsitul instalarii .

Urmatorul pas il facem din Command Prompt . Asadar dam dublu-click pe Start si click pe butonul Run . Acolo scriem cmd , iar dupa aceea urmatoarea comanda :
Cod:
cd C:\HLDS
.

Acum el descarca toate fisierele HLDS, HLTV-ul si nucleul VALVE (game engine). Odata ce a terminat instalarea va aparea urmatorul mesaj :
Cod:
HLDS Installation Up To Date

Dupa ce am terminat de downloadat fisierele serverului, va trebui sa downloadam fisierele modulului pe care il vrem instalat (in cazul nostru Counter-Strike). Ca si inainte, aceasta se face in acelasi Command Prompt in care scriem urmatoarea comanda:
Cod:
hldsupdatetool.exe -command update -game cstrike -dir

Ok , cand se va termina instalarea va aparea acelasi mesaj ca si mai sus adica HLDS Installation Up To Date . Acum va trebui sa dezarhivam fisierul hldsw32.patch.3382.rar in : Local Disk (:C) -> HLDS . Intram dupa aceea in Local Disk (:C) -> HLDS -> cstrike si deschidem cu NOTEPAD fisierul server.cfg . Stergem TOT ce este in el si adaugam urmatoarele CVARS-uri :
Cod:
hostname "Numele Serverului"
mp_autokick 0
mp_autocrosshair 0
mp_autoteambalance 0
mp_buytime 2
mp_consistency 1
mp_c4timer 35
mp_fadetoblack 0
mp_falldamage 0
mp_flashlight 1
mp_forcecamera 3
mp_forcechasecam 2
mp_friendlyfire 1
mp_freezetime 3
mp_fraglimit 0
mp_hostagepenalty 0
mp_limitteams 6
mp_logfile 1
mp_logmessages 1
mp_logdetail 3
mp_maxrounds 0
mp_playerid 0
mp_roundtime 3
mp_startmoney 800
mp_timelimit 35
mp_tkpunish 0
mp_winlimit 0

sv_aim 0
sv_airaccelerate 10
sv_airmove 1
sv_allowdownload 1
sv_clienttrace 1.0
sv_clipmode 0
sv_allowupload 1
sv_cheats 0
sv_gravity 800
sv_lan 1
sv_maxrate 7000
sv_maxspeed 320
sv_maxupdaterate 101
sys_ticrate 10000
decalfrequency 60
pausable 0
log on
decalfrequency 60
edgefriction 2
host_framerate 0
exec listip.cfg
exec banned.cfg
rcon_password PAROLA


La HOSTNAME putem scrie orice. De exemplu "CS Gaming Brasov". Ce scriem aici, le apare jucatorilor sus cand apasa TAB. Mai departe, la PAROLA trecem o parola cu care vom putea controla serverul de la distanta. In rest, nu schimbati nimic decat daca stiti exact despre ce e vorba.

Ok , am trecut si de aceasta etapa . Urmeaza instalarea modului AdminMod . Deci , dezarhivam fisierul halflife-admin-2.50.60-win.rar oriunde . Vom avea un folder nou numit AdminMod . Intram in el si executam dublu-click pe install_admin.vbs. Apasam OK dupa care ne intreaba unde anume sa-l instalam. Probabil va gasi mai multe Target-uri , pe noi ne intereseaza C:\HLDS deci scriem in casuta de jos numarul aferent pentru C:\HLDS. De exemplu pentru 2) Dedicated Server (C:\HLDS) scriem in casuta 2 si apasam OK. Apoi ne intreaba pentru ce MOD vrem sa il instalam. Scriem in casuta 1 (pentru cstrike). Ok si cam asta e .

Bun , acum sa configuram AdminMod-ul . Deci , apasam Start -> MyComputer -> Local Disk(:C) -> HLDS -> cstrike ->addons -> adminmod ->config si dam dublu-click pe iconita de la fisierul adminmod.cfg . Chiar daca sunt explicate si ele in MARE parte , vi le voi explica si eu pentru a nu intampina probleme pe serverul dumneavoastra :

• admin_balance_teams - Nu ne intereseaza, il lasam 0
• admin_bot_protection - Daca este setat 0 si rulam un server cu boti, aceast cvar lasa adminii sa dea slay, kick, ban si mai multe botilor.
• admin_connect_msg - Acesta este mesajul ce apare unui jucator in mijlocul ecranului dupa ce s-a conectat.
• admin_cs_restrict - Il punem de preferat 1 pentru a putea restrictiona armele in joc. (anti-apasaci)
• admin_debug - N-avem treaba, il lasam 0
• admin_fun_mode - De preferat il lasam 0. Acest cvar e pentru a face jucatorii sa straluceasca intr-o culoare (glow blue).
• admin_fx - Il punem 1. Efecte speciale.
• admin_gag_name - 0 sau 1 in functie de preferinta.
• admin_gag_sayteam - La fel.
• admin_highlander - Ar trebui lasat 0. Daca il trecem 1, doar un singur admin, cel mai mare, va avea access la comenzi. De ex daca pe server sunt 3 admini, cel mai mare ramane, iar celati 2 raman simple sloturi.
• admin_ignore_immunity - Aici depinde de gusturi. Daca e pus 1, adminii, moderatorii si ceilalti jucatori cu imunitate isi pot da/lua slay-uri, kick, ban etc intre ei.
• admin_repeat_msg - Un mesaj ce apare cu verde in mijlocul ecranului o data la cateva minute.
• admin_quiet - Daca trecem 0, comenzile date de admin vor aparea cu tot cu nickul lui. Daca trecem 1, comenzile vor aparea dar in locul nickului adminului va aparea doar "Admin" iar daca trecem 2, comenzile nu vor aparea deloc.
• allow_client_exec - Neaparat 1 ! Cu asta putem obliga jucatorii sa execute orice comanda (quit etc)
• password_field - Poate cel mai important cvar. Ce trecem aici, vor trebui adminii nostri sa scrie in consola inainte de a se conecta la server. De exemplu daca punem _parola, adminul "X" cu parola "XYZ" va trebuie sa scrie in consola name X si apoi setinfo _parola XYZ inainte de a se conecta la serverul nostru.
• reserve_slots - Aici trecem cate locuri rezervate are serverul. Treceti in jur de 2-3. Asta lasa adminii si sloturile rezervate sa se poata conecta atunci cand serverul este plin.
• reserve_type - Lasati 0. E cel mai bine. Daca sunteti curiosi ce face, cititi manualul Adminmod-ului.

Veti observa ca unele variabile nu le-am trecut. Asta inseamna ca e recomandat sa le lasati asa cum sunt .

Daca doriti admini pe serverul dumneavoastra , ceea ce cred ca da , urmati urmatorii pasi . Apasam dublu-click pe Start -> MyComputer -> Local Disk (:C) -> HLDS -> cstrike -> addons -> adminmod -> config si dam dublu-click pe fisierul users.ini . De exemplu , daca dorim sa ii facem unui jucator admin MAXIM (inseamna sa aiba toate comenzile) ii veti cere ce nume si ce parola doreste pe server . De exemplu daca vrea admin cu nick-ul "gaMer" , parola "1234" si acces la TOATE comenzile "131071" vom trece in users.ini urmatorul lucru :
Cod:
gaMer:1234:131071

Pentru a calcula accesele unui admin pe serverul dumneavoastra , intram aici

Mai eficient decat sa scriem setinfo _pw(sau cum ai selectat tu in fisierul adminmod.cfg) este sa ne conectam la server cu numele din users.ini iar in consola sa scriem :
Cod:
admin_password 1234(1234 fiind un exemplu de parola)

Bun , acum facem ultimul lucru inainte de pornirea serverului ! Dezarhivam StatsMe 2.8.3.rar in Local Disk(:C) -> HLDS -> cstrike . Dupa aceea , mergem in Local Disk (:C) -> HLDS -> cstrike -> addons -> metamod si deschidem fisierul plugins.ini si adaugam urmatoarea linie deasupra celor existente deja :
Cod:
win32 addons\statsme\dlls\statsme_mm.dll

Apoi mergem in Local Disk(:C) -> HLDS -> cstrike -> addons -> statsme -> si deschidem fisierul statsme.cfg si modificam parola "r3wt" cu o alta parola . Neeaparat trebuie modificata parola altfel nu vor merge niste lucruri. Apoi cand vom intra in joc, vom scrie in consola statsme_menu parola-trecuta-in-statsme.cfg pentru a modifica ultimele setari . Ca sa functioneze comenzile /rank si /top10 , tot in statsme.cfg modificam la sm_storebyauth in loc de 1 punem 0 . Asadar vom avea urmatoarea linie :
Cod:
sm_storebyauth 0


Urmatorul pas este sa dez-securizam serverul . Asadar , mergem in Local Disk(:C) -> HLDS -> cstrike si executam dublu-click pe fisierul liblist.gam . Acolo vom modifica secure "1" cu secure "0" salvam si iesim .

Acum pornim serverul . Eu voi folosi metoda cea mai simpla de pornire a serverului . Deci mergem in Local Disk(:C) -> HLDS si executam dublu click pe iconita de la hlds.exe . Apoi , selectam optiunile dupa cum vi le prezint eu acum :

Game : Counter-Strike
Server Name : De exemplu CS Gaming Brasov
Map : Orice
Network : Internet
Max. Players : cati doresti
UDP Port: portul pe care va rula serverul. Daca il schimbati pe cel default (27015), playerii ce vor vrea sa se conecteze, va trebuie sa scrie in consola connect server.ip:port.nou
RCON Password: O parola cu care veti controla serverul de la distanta
Secure (Valve Anti-Cheat): Atentie sa fie deselectat acel box.

Acesta a fost tutorialul meu de creere al serverului de Counter-Strike , astept pareri si nelamuriri daca aveti !
knoxville
knoxville
Ajutor Minim
Ajutor Minim

Numarul mesajelor : 71
Varsta : 29
Localizare : Printre pinguini
Data de inscriere : 09/05/2008

https://none.ace.st

Sus In jos

[TUTORIAL]Instalare Server Counter-Strike 1.6 (NON-STEAM) Empty Re: [TUTORIAL]Instalare Server Counter-Strike 1.6 (NON-STEAM)

Mesaj  DarKy. Vin Mai 09, 2008 12:40 pm

Bine Ai Venit ! in primul rand si in al doilea rand cheers gJ = GooD Job Smile ....
DarKy.
DarKy.
Ajutor
Ajutor

Numarul mesajelor : 129
Varsta : 33
Localizare : Ploiesti
Data de inscriere : 14/03/2008

http://Sm-CommuniTy.Ace.ST

Sus In jos

Sus

- Subiecte similare

 
Permisiunile acestui forum:
Nu puteti raspunde la subiectele acestui forum